With Child, Without Workplace Accommodation
Sep 23, 2022 | Laurel C. MontagThe Seventh Circuit Court held on August 16, 2022, that employers have considerable leeway in excluding pregnant employees from some accommodation policies, so long as the employer can offer a legitimate, nondiscriminatory business reason for doing so.
